Block Wall Replacement in West Hartford, CT

Block wall replacement services involve removing and replacing existing block walls that have become damaged, deteriorated, or no longer meet the property's needs. These projects typically include residential boundary walls, retaining walls, garden enclosures, or decorative features. Property owners often seek this service when their current wall shows signs of cracking, bowing, or structural failure, or when aesthetic improvements are desired. Before requesting a replacement, it’s helpful to understand the condition of the existing wall, the intended purpose of the new structure,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ply.

Homeowners should consider the type of block material, the design style, and the overall purpose of the wall to ensure the replacement aligns with property needs and aesthetic preferences. It’s also important to evaluate the foundation and soil conditions, as these factors influence the longevity and stability of the new wall. Clear communication about project scope, material choices, and any specific concerns will assist in planning a replacement that enhances both the appearance and functionality of the property.

Block Wall Replacement Questions

What are common reasons to replace a block wall? Block walls may need replacement due to cracking, shifting, or deterioration from weather and age.

How can I tell if my block wall needs replacement? Signs include significant cracks, leaning, or crumbling mortar that compromise stability.

What types of projects typically involve block wall replacement? Projects often include replacing damaged garden walls, retaining walls, or boundary enclosures.

What should property owners consider before replacing a block wall? It's important to evaluate the extent of damage and select suitable materials for durability and aesthetics.
